Software Engineering Manager – Full Stack
Software Engineering Manager – Full Stack

Software Engineering Manager – Full Stack

Hounslow Full-Time 43200 - 72000 £ / year (est.) No home office possible
B

At a Glance

  • Tasks: Lead teams to deliver high-quality, scalable software solutions in a dynamic environment.
  • Company: Join British Airways, a pioneering airline connecting Britain with the world for over 100 years.
  • Benefits: Enjoy staff travel perks, discounted airfares, and opportunities for career growth.
  • Why this job: Be part of a world-class engineering team shaping the future of technology.
  • Qualifications: Experience in full-stack development, particularly Java, React, AWS, and agile methodologies.
  • Other info: We value diversity and inclusion, encouraging unique perspectives in our workplace.

The predicted salary is between 43200 - 72000 £ per year.

A career without limits. As the nation’s flag carrier, we take great pride in connecting Britain with the world and the world with Britain. This originality has been in our blood since day one. It’s the spirit we share with the people that fly with us, our partners, and our colleagues. A job at British Airways is yours to make.

The Role: Software Engineering Manager (Full Stack Focus)

Join our innovative Software Engineering team at British Airways as a Software Engineering Manager, where you’ll play a key role in leading teams to deliver high-quality, scalable, and secure software solutions. With a focus on large scale full-stack development, this role is ideal for those who thrive in a dynamic and collaborative environment, bringing expertise in AWS, Microservices, API, and DevOps.

What You’ll Do:

  • Lead internal and external teams of software engineers, fostering a culture of trust, collaboration and continuous improvement.
  • Develop and execute full-stack development strategies, ensuring scalable, high-performance software solutions.
  • Work closely with stakeholders to define technical requirements and translate them into actionable development plans.
  • Proactively evaluate the current state of the product development and work with CoEs to drive sustainable improvements in the team and across the organisation.
  • Drive the adoption of modern DevOps practices in the team to enhance software delivery and operational efficiency.
  • Champion best practices in software engineering, ensuring security, maintainability, and performance.
  • Present technical solutions and progress to stakeholders, translating complex concepts into clear business value.
  • Build strong relationships across teams, acting as a bridge between engineering and business functions.

What You’ll Bring to British Airways:

  • Proven experience working on enterprise-level software engineering programmes.
  • A deep understanding of modern full-stack development, particularly Java, React, and AWS.
  • Strong stakeholder management and communication skills, with the ability to present technical concepts clearly.
  • Experience with DevOps tools and methodologies, enabling efficient and secure software delivery.
  • A growth-focused leadership style, with a passion for continuous improvement.
  • A proactive, problem-solving mindset, with the ability to drive innovation and change.
  • Ability to balance between applying the fundamentals and taking a pragmatic solution.

Your Experience:

  • Proven experience in full-stack software engineering, with a strong technical foundation.
  • Expertise in Java, React, AWS, and modern cloud-native architectures.
  • Experience leading teams in an agile development environment.
  • Strong DevOps knowledge, with experience in CI/CD pipelines and automation.

This is your chance to be part of a world-class engineering team, shaping the future of technology at British Airways. Apply now and take your career to new heights!

What we offer:

We believe that all the people who work with us should feel valued for the part they play. From the day you join us, you’ll get access to brilliant staff travel benefits including unlimited basic and premium standby tickets on British Airways flights. You’ll also receive up to 30 discounted ‘Hotline’ airfares per year for yourself, friends, and family. At British Airways you’ll have the chance to take on new challenges and move forward in a way that feels right for you.

Inclusion & Diversity

At British Airways we all have a part to play in creating an inclusive place to work. Diverse representation among our people is really important to us and we recognise that all our colleagues are uniquely different and bring their own originality, creativity and identity to work. Inclusion and diversity is a key driver of innovation and we’re committed to creating a culture where everyone feels that they can be themselves.

Software Engineering Manager – Full Stack employer: British Airways

At British Airways, we pride ourselves on being an exceptional employer, offering a dynamic and collaborative work culture that fosters innovation and continuous improvement. As a Software Engineering Manager, you'll not only lead talented teams in delivering cutting-edge software solutions but also enjoy unparalleled benefits such as extensive staff travel perks and opportunities for personal and professional growth. Join us in shaping the future of technology while being part of a diverse and inclusive environment that values your unique contributions.
B

Contact Detail:

British Airways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Engineering Manager – Full Stack

Tip Number 1

Familiarise yourself with the latest trends in full-stack development, particularly focusing on Java, React, and AWS. This knowledge will not only help you during interviews but also demonstrate your commitment to staying current in a rapidly evolving field.

Tip Number 2

Network with current or former employees of British Airways, especially those in software engineering roles. They can provide valuable insights into the company culture and expectations, which can be crucial for tailoring your approach.

Tip Number 3

Prepare to discuss your leadership style and experiences in fostering collaboration within teams. British Airways values a growth-focused leadership approach, so be ready to share specific examples of how you've driven continuous improvement in past roles.

Tip Number 4

Brush up on your DevOps knowledge, particularly around CI/CD pipelines and automation tools. Being able to articulate how you've implemented these practices in previous projects will set you apart as a candidate who can enhance software delivery efficiency.

We think you need these skills to ace Software Engineering Manager – Full Stack

Full-Stack Development
Java
React
AWS
Microservices Architecture
API Development
DevOps Practices
CI/CD Pipelines
Agile Methodologies
Stakeholder Management
Technical Communication
Problem-Solving Skills
Leadership and Team Management
Continuous Improvement Mindset
Cloud-Native Architectures

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ience in full-stack development, particularly with Java, React, and AWS. Emphasise any leadership roles you've held and your ability to manage teams effectively.

Craft a Compelling Cover Letter: In your cover letter, express your passion for software engineering and how your skills align with the role at British Airways. Mention specific projects where you have successfully implemented DevOps practices or led teams in agile environments.

Showcase Your Technical Skills: Include a section in your application that showcases your technical skills relevant to the job description. Highlight your experience with microservices, APIs, and CI/CD pipelines, as well as any certifications you may have.

Prepare for Potential Questions: Think about how you would answer questions related to stakeholder management and presenting technical concepts. Be ready to discuss your problem-solving approach and how you drive innovation within a team.

How to prepare for a job interview at British Airways

Showcase Your Technical Expertise

Be prepared to discuss your experience with Java, React, and AWS in detail. Highlight specific projects where you successfully implemented full-stack solutions, and be ready to explain the technical challenges you faced and how you overcame them.

Demonstrate Leadership Skills

As a Software Engineering Manager, you'll need to lead teams effectively. Share examples of how you've fostered collaboration and trust within your teams, and discuss your approach to mentoring and developing team members.

Communicate Clearly with Stakeholders

Practice explaining complex technical concepts in simple terms. Be ready to discuss how you've previously worked with stakeholders to define requirements and translate them into actionable plans, ensuring everyone is on the same page.

Emphasise Continuous Improvement

Highlight your proactive approach to evaluating and improving processes. Discuss any initiatives you've led that drove innovation or efficiency, particularly in relation to DevOps practices and agile methodologies.

Software Engineering Manager – Full Stack
British Airways
B
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>